Title: Newbie Network E1.31 sCAN LOR Help
Post by: PvtJoker on June 01, 2017, 09:13:27 AM
First off thank you everyone!!

Ok First the Equipment....
I have is 2 AlphaPix 16 controllers,  1 AlphaPix 4 controller and 7 LOR controllers and 1 E1.31 (sCAN) bridge for the LOR. All 3 AlphaPix controllers & the Bridge are hooked up to a Netgear GB switch and output 1 on the E1.31 is set to universe 50.

Ok now the problem...
In Xlights I have it set up the following way the LOR controllers are on Universe 50 at the top and the AlphaPix controllers starting at universe 1 to 36 just below. Now the funny part ... when I first hooked everything up directly from the laptop to the switch and ran the sequencer or Tester in xlights all the Pixels worked but not the LOR controllers. When I hooked the switch into my network with internet the pixels stopped working but the LOR controllers would work.  I then changed all the ip addresses on the AlphaPix controllers and the E1.31 (sCAN)to match my Subnet and Gateway but all that did was make it that I could control pixels wirelessly but not the LOR. Also when the FPP is hooked directly into the switch the same happens only the Pixels work but not the LOR thru the E1.31 sCAN that is hooked into the switch.

Any help would be appreciated!  :)

Post by: Gilrock on June 01, 2017, 11:20:54 AM
Just a litte nit the acronym is sACN for streaming ACN.  Since you are running the LOR outputs through an E1.31 bridge it's not a requirement that they be listed first.  I believe the requirement to list them first is only if you are importing LMS data from LOR.  To xLights it just looks like another E1.31 output.  I would recommend to try setting everything to unicast.  Some hardware doesn't handle multicast well.
